Step 1: Define Injection Mold Specifications

First, detail your exact specifications so mold makers can properly quote and fulfill your needs:

  • Products/parts to be molded
  • Plastic materials (PE, PP, ABS etc.)
  • Shot sizes, clamping force
  • Cavity dimensions and layout
  • Cooling requirements
  • Surface finishes and tolerances
  • Estimated annual volumes
  • Target cycle times
  • Any special features

Provide 3D CAD models or drawings if possible. Being specific upfront ensures you get qualified quotes.

Step 3: Send RFQs and Evaluate Quotes

Send your complete mold specifications and requirements by RFQ to the shortlisted vendors. Wait 2-3 days for quotes and thoroughly evaluate:

  • Quoted price relative to other suppliers
  • Completeness of quote - all your needs addressed?
  • Proposed timeline realistic?
  • Willingness to optimize design
  • Acceptance of your requested terms
  • Responsiveness and communication

Follow up for clarification on any unclear points. Narrow down to 2-3 best suited mold makers.

Step 4: Check Certifications and Credentials

Vet the finalists thoroughly to validate capabilities and credibility:

  • Verify ISO 9001 or ISO 14001 compliance
  • Check for in-house equipment like CNC machining
  • Review online reputation and testimonials
  • Request referrals from existing customers
  • Look for expertise in molding your type of parts

This due diligence is crucial for avoiding potential quality or reliability issues.

Step 6: Place a Test Order

Before a full production order, have the chosen vendor make 1-2 molds as a trial run. Inspect carefully:

  • Design accuracy vs. specifications
  • Mold performance - cycle times, tolerances, finish etc.
  • Quality of molded part samples
  • Independent third-party inspection advised

Test orders validate capabilities and quality before investment in full molds.

Step 7: Negotiate Pricing and Finalize the Order

If satisfied with the trial molds, negotiate any changes to pricing and terms with your selected China mold partner. Get everything formalized under a detailed mold supply contract.

Confirm timelines, project plans, inspection procedures, payment terms etc. to avoid delays or confusion. Collaborate closely throughout fabrication - timely approvals and feedback keep things on track.
